Objectives
In this subject, you'll be introduced to the dynamic world of the media and associated industries, and their influence on society and the individual.
Through a combination of theory, application and practice, you will emerge with a greater understanding of how the media works and an ability to design and produce a range of media products.
Course outline
Semester 1
- Media literacy, media representation, film language, genre theory, audiences
- The story of film: from silent movies to blockbusters
- Film marketing and advertising: the trailer and film poster
Semester 2
- Journalism and the newsroom: online and broadcast
- Marketing and communications: traditional and new media advertising forms, brands and bran identity and public relations.
Assessment
Assignments: 25%
Major project: 20%
Exams: mid year 20%; final 30%
In-class tasks and participation: 5%
